Zofia Kwolek
Polish Center for International Aid (PL)

Zofia is a highly skilled and effective fundraising and communication executive with almost two decades of experience in the humanitarian sector, both international (UNICEF) and local (PCPM – Polish Center for International Aid). Throughout her career, she went through different roles and tasks, from a spokesperson of an organization to a chief of fundraising and marketing director. Usually ‘wearing multiple hats‘ at the same time and learning how to achieve more with less. Her professional experience includes implementing such back-end tools as online payment solutions and CRM software, as well as creating marketing, PR and fundraising strategies, budgeting and organizing national public awareness campaigns.

During her time at UNICEF Zofia had managed to organize a fundraising campaign that brought over 5M of PLN (Polish zloty). She also obtained and managed a Google Grant worth 10.000 USD/month; created a social media strategy and crafted a 3-year long CSR strategy for a corporate partner with 1M PLN of revenue. During the last two years with the PCPM Zofia has created a fundraising strategy from scratch; achieved six-fold growth of donations from individual donors; started the first strategic business partnership for the PCPM and obtained significant pro-bono and in-kind support from various institutions.
